Realty Mart Management Inc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Realty Mart Management Inc in the United States is $89,531.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$43. Salaries at Realty Mart Management Inc typically range from $78,687 to $101,283 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Detroit?

Understanding the cost of living near Detroit is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Realty Mart Management Inc.
Detroit's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.6 (2.4% less expensive than US average; 6.9% more than MI average). Housing varies extremely by neighborhood (very cheap to expensive gentrified), overall costs can be low. DDOT/SMART bus, QLine. When planning your budget based on a salary from Realty Mart Management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$800 - $1,500+ (Highly variable) A significant portion of Realty Mart Management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(DDOT/SMART mon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,130 - $3,660+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
